How Dangerous Is Internal haemorrhage From SPIRONOLACTONE?
Of the 21 reports, 7 (33.3%) resulted in death, 10 (47.6%) required hospitalization, and 1 (4.8%) were considered life-threatening.
Is Internal haemorrhage Listed in the Official Label?
This adverse event is not currently listed in the official FDA drug label for SPIRONOLACTONE. However, 21 reports have been filed with the FAERS database.
